PEMBROKE PINES, Fla., February 16, 2026— Kaluz Restaurant raised funds for the South Broward Foundation by donating a portion of sales from the opening VIP Night at its new Pembroke Pines location. The contribution totaled $7,500 and will support education and leadership initiatives in the Pembroke Pines and Miramar communities.
A local nonprofit affiliated with its Chamber of Commerce, the South Broward Foundation aligns closely with Kaluz’s commitment to giving back to the community it serves. A new outdoor pavilion designed to give teens a welcoming place to relax, connect, and enjoy time together on campus PEMBROKE PINES, FL, January 16, 2026 (EINPresswire.com) - Children’s Harbor proudly celebrated a special ribbon-cutting ceremony on Tuesday, January 13th, to officially unveil The Harbor Hangout, the organization’s newest campus space. The ceremony was coordinated by the Miramar/Pembroke Pines Chamber of Commerce and attended by members of the City Commission, the Mayor of Pembroke Pines Mayor Angelo Castillo, Commissioner Maria Rodriguez, Vice Mayor of Oakland Park, Aisha Gordon, Senator Dr. Barbara Sharief, Children’s Harbor board members, staff, and community supporters.
The Harbor Hangout is a thoughtfully designed outdoor pavilion featuring lounge-style seating and open gathering areas where teens can relax, connect, and simply be kids while enjoying time outside. Created with intention and care, the space reflects a deep understanding of the needs of the young people Children’s Harbor serves and will have a lasting impact on campus life for years to come. This project was made possible through the extraordinary leadership and dedication of Peyton Ross, an Eagle Scout candidate and the son of Children’s Harbor’s Board Chair Karen Ross. Over the course of a year and a half, Peyton led the project from concept to completion as his Eagle Scout service project. He designed plans, coordinated vendors, managed construction, and successfully raised $10,000 in fundraising and over $50,000 through professional in-kind services generously donated by community partners. On Saturday, November 22, Calvin Giordano & Associates employees volunteered alongside more than 100 community volunteers to support the Prestige Club’s Annual Children’s Picnic at Bamford Park, which brought together more than 1,600 children and families facing hardship across Broward County.
CGA has supported The Prestige Club for nearly three decades, contributing more than $100,000 to-date and providing long-term volunteer leadership, including Executive Assistant Dawn Hopkins, who has volunteered with the organization for 17 years and helps coordinate volunteer logistics each year. SAFEbuilt CEO Chris Giordano was also onsite volunteering; his late father, Dennis Giordano, was one of Prestige Club’s founding members. The event featured games, activities, character entertainment, and educational stations, as well as the signature Santa’s Mailbox, where children write letters requesting holiday wishes.
